Q: Is 861,338 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 861,338 is not a prime number.

Why is 861,338 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 861338 can be evenly divided by 1 2 269 538 1,601 3,202 430,669 and 861,338, with no remainder.

Since 861,338 cannot be divided by just 1 and 861,338, it is not a prime number.
